SHEAR AND NORMAL STRESSES INTERACTION IN COUPLED STRUCTURAL SYSTEMS

摘要

A unified approach to evaluate the behavior of composite structural elements is proposed considering the interaction between the shear and normal stresses due to the connecting system. The model assumes linear behavior for the materials and connection and allows one to analyze different structural problems in the serviceability conditions. Numerical examples show that many classical coupled problems could be analyzed by a unified approach; in particular, the coupled shear walls subject to horizontal loads, steel-concrete composite beams with stud connectors, and reinforced beams strengthened with external plates are considered.
